Rescued eagle Jackie battles anemia, inflammation. 'It's too early to predict the outcome'

Rescued Big Bear eagle Jackie has anemia and kidney inflammation, and remains in critical condition. However, she is eating and even fighting with care staff, according to an educational nonprofit.

Weather conditions shut down Canal Fest on Tuesday

BUFFALO, N.Y. (WIVB) -- Canal Fest of the Tonawandas is canceled Tuesday night due to weather conditions, officials said. Scattered showers and thunderstorms forecasted around Western New York shut down Tuesday's festivities at Gratwick Park in North Tonawanda. Stay updated on the latest forecast here.

EPA to test inside homes after News 4 Investigates radiation discovery

NIAGARA FALLS, N.Y. (WIVB) -- State and federal officials said Monday they will test inside homes after News 4 Investigates found elevated radiation inside two homes in the Town of Niagara.
